baochun2455
码龄8年
关注
提问 私信
  • 博客:1,804
    1,804
    总访问量
  • 暂无
    原创
  • 2,207,695
    排名
  • 0
    粉丝
  • 0
    铁粉
  • 加入CSDN时间: 2017-03-27
博客简介:

baochun2455的博客

查看详细资料
  • 原力等级
    当前等级
    0
    当前总分
    0
    当月
    0
个人成就
  • 获得0次点赞
  • 内容获得0次评论
  • 获得0次收藏
创作历程
  • 10篇
    2019年
创作活动更多

超级创作者激励计划

万元现金补贴,高额收益分成,专属VIP内容创作者流量扶持,等你加入!

去参加
  • 最近
  • 文章
  • 代码仓
  • 资源
  • 问答
  • 帖子
  • 视频
  • 课程
  • 关注/订阅/互动
  • 收藏
搜TA的内容
搜索 取消

2.5路由网关:Zuul

在原有的工程上,创建一个新的工程创建service-zuul工程其pom.xml文件如下:<?xml version="1.0" encoding="UTF-8"?><project xmlns="http://maven.apache.org/POM/4.0.0" xmlns:xsi="http://www.w3.org/2001/XMLSchema-in...
转载
发布博客 2019.09.20 ·
104 阅读 ·
0 点赞 ·
0 评论 ·
0 收藏

2.4容错保护:Hystrix

在ribbon使用断路器改造serice-ribbon 工程的代码,首先在pox.xml文件中加入spring-cloud-starter-hystrix的起步依赖:引入<dependency> <groupId>org.springframework.cloud</groupId> <artifactId>spri...
转载
发布博客 2019.09.20 ·
118 阅读 ·
0 点赞 ·
0 评论 ·
0 收藏

2.3负载均衡:Ribbon

基于上一篇文章的工程,启动eureka-server 工程;启动service-hi工程,它的端口为8765;将service-hi的配置文件的端口改为8763,并启动,这时你会发现:service-hi在eureka-server注册了2个实例,这就相当于一个小的集群。重新新建一个spring-boot工程,取名为:service-ribbon;在它的pom.xml文件分别引入起步...
转载
发布博客 2019.09.20 ·
124 阅读 ·
0 点赞 ·
0 评论 ·
0 收藏

2.2注册中心:Eureka

pom.xml配置 <?xml version="1.0" encoding="UTF-8"?><project xmlns="http://maven.apache.org/POM/4.0.0" x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ance" xsi:schemaLocation="http://m...
转载
发布博客 2019.09.20 ·
115 阅读 ·
0 点赞 ·
0 评论 ·
0 收藏

2.1spring cloud 环境配置

前提:SpringBoot可以离开SpringCloud独立使用开发项目,但是SpringCloud离不开SpringBoot,属于依赖的关系.所以基本是搭建SpringBoot + 组件 = SpringCloud什么是Spring Cloud  1、Spring Cloud它不是一个具体的框架,它是一个工具箱,它提供了各类工具,可以帮助我们快速地构建分布式系统。  2...
转载
发布博客 2019.09.20 ·
95 阅读 ·
0 点赞 ·
0 评论 ·
0 收藏

1.2异常处理和服务配置、aop、日志、自定义事件处理

一、异常处理2.1、数据验证现在假设说要进行表单信息提交,肯定需要有一个表单,而后这个表单要将数据提交到 VO 类中,所以现在的基本实现如下:1、 建立一个 Member.java 的 VO 类:package cn.study.microboot.vo;import java.io.Serializable;import java.util.Date...
转载
发布博客 2019.09.17 ·
308 阅读 ·
0 点赞 ·
0 评论 ·
0 收藏

1.5JdbcTmeplates、Jpa、Mybatis、beatlsql、Druid的使用

Spring boot 连接数据库整合-- create table `account`DROP TABLE `account` IF EXISTSCREATE TABLE `account` ( `id` int(11) NOT NULL AUTO_INCREMENT, `name` varchar(20) NOT NULL, `money` double DEFAULT N...
转载
发布博客 2019.09.19 ·
176 阅读 ·
0 点赞 ·
0 评论 ·
0 收藏

1.4Zookeeper和Thymeleaf的使用

什么是Zookeeper?Zookeeper 是一个开放源码的分布式应用程序协调服务,它包含一个简单的原语集,分布式应用程序可以基于它实现同步服务、配置维护和命名服务等等。采用下图描述zookeeper协调服务。Zookeeper特性ZooKeeper非常快速且非常简单。但是,由于其目标是构建更复杂的服务(如同步)的基础,因此它提供了一系列保证。这些是:顺序一致性 -...
转载
发布博客 2019.09.19 ·
123 阅读 ·
0 点赞 ·
0 评论 ·
0 收藏

1.3Security:权限管理,过滤、监听、拦截

Security:权限管理常用权限拦截器SecurityContextPersistenceFilter以前是HttpSesstionContextIntegrationFilter,位于过滤器的顶端,是第一个起作用的过滤器第一个用途:在执行其他过滤器之前,率先判断用户的session是否已经存在了一个spring security上下文的securityCo...
转载
发布博客 2019.09.17 ·
450 阅读 ·
0 点赞 ·
0 评论 ·
0 收藏

1.1Spring Boot 环境配置和常用注解

Spring Boot常用注解:@Service: 注解在类上,表示这是一个业务层bean@Controller:注解在类上,表示这是一个控制层bean@Repository: 注解在类上,表示这是一个数据访问层bean@Component: 注解在类上,表示通用bean ,value不写默认就是类名首字母小写@Autowired:按类型注入.默认属性required= true;当不能...
转载
发布博客 2019.09.16 ·
200 阅读 ·
0 点赞 ·
0 评论 ·
0 收藏